    Quote Originally Posted by Fakepower View Post
    I had a set of 6speed cables in all of those pictures. I wish I wouldn't have switched over, the 6 speed cables only have one adjustable cable while the 5 speed both cables are adjustable.
    I must have the wrong cables or in 91 there was only 1 adjustable cable. Perhaps this is why my trans feels weird to shift.

    Quote Originally Posted by Bloodlust182 View Post
    I must have the wrong cables or in 91 there was only 1 adjustable cable. Perhaps this is why my trans feels weird to shift.
    There is a pic or white band on them, which tells whether they are 6 or 5 speed cables.

    Emily had a great thread on it:
